Tackling this misfire. I'm not a noob lol.. Please give me some input

Yes I Posted on n54tech... lolll


The other day driving with some e85 in the tank map7 and my methanol kit barely spraying I did a WOT throttle pull. Well a couple of them lol.

I am in 3rd and get a misfire and the car sounds like a truck. It was happening at the track recently also. But I restart the car and it usually goes away.

This time it did NOT go away upon restarting the car...

I was getting misfires on 2 and 5.. sometimes 6.. The car was running really really bad.

I looked at the plugs and checked the gaps which are gapped at .022 (the one step colder NGK's) picture attached.

I replaced all new coils today and now I'm getting a cylinder 6 misfire only. and the car isn't running as bad. I'm guessing because only one cylinder is misfiring now.

I moved the coil packs around and the misfire did not follow...

What else could be my problem thats causing this misfire?

I also washed the engine bay but the car started and ran fine after that for a good 40 minutes. and I used a leaf blower to blow all the water out.

The plugs were dry. Not wet. Could it still be an injector? The only code I am getting is 29D2 Misfirings Cylinder 6.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Compman View Post
Can I switch the injectors around? Put cylinder 1 in cylinder 6? To confirm it is the injector?
I've read on the forum, and spoken to other e90 members in person who've recommended switching injectors (and coding) across cylinders to test misfire.

I myself never tried this method as i have also read that the little rubber on injectors goes bad upon removal... Conflicting info huh...

When i had cyl 5 issues i just changed that whole injector for a new one after trying all the other less expensive options
